About Woodstock, Vermont

Woodstock unfolds with a grace that feels as old as the Vermont hills themselves. It lies 57.0 miles west-north-west of Concord, NH (from Concord, NH: bearing 301°T), and is situated 9.1 miles south-west of Jericho. Rolling terrain, softened by a generous cloak of deciduous forest, gives way to meadows that in summer hum with the quiet industry of bees. The Ottauquechee River, a ribbon of cool, clear water, threads its way through the valley, its banks often lined with ancient stone walls that speak of past endeavors. The air here carries a crispness, a clean scent of pine and damp earth, especially potent after a rain shower. Buildings, predominantly of clapboard and brick, cluster around a central green, their facades often painted in hues of muted pastels or deep forest greens, reflecting the enduring charm of New England architecture. Sunlight, when it breaks through the canopy, falls in wide, benevolent shafts, illuminating the weathered wood and the bright splashes of blooming hydrangeas. This valley has long been a place of quiet prosperity, its history intertwined with the cycles of agriculture and a discerning appreciation for craftsmanship. Early settlers, drawn by the fertile soil and the power of the river, established mills that once echoed with the thrum of industry, their remnants now often incorporated into the charming structures that house independent shops and galleries. Woodstock's economy today thrives on a blend of tourism, drawn by its quintessential Vermont character and its proximity to ski resorts, and a continued commitment to local artisans and producers. The village retains a sense of purpose, a gentle hum of daily life where the local bakery’s aroma can be a marker of the morning, and the evening brings a soft glow from the windows of its historic homes, a quiet testament to generations who have found their footing here.
